Manière De Voir to open flagship store in London’s Oxford Street

Manchester-based Manière De Voir have announced they have signed a 10 year lease for their first physical store, at 354 Oxford Street in London, an area renowned for shopping. With an estimated nine million tourists flocking to Oxford Street per year, the estimated footfall of 72,700 visitors a day will only increase MDV’s global profile and status.

The move highlights the brands intent to continue their remarkable growth as a fashion brand, and the decade long lease shows how confident they are with the move into retail. No doubt there will be envious glances from their rivals as London’s main shopping hub is the busiest in Europe and the store will have 86 foot gross frontage to catch the eye of the international tourists.

The flagship store is at the 5,189 square foot retail unit Oxbourne House is located above Bond Street Tube station, with the new Elizabeth line expected to bring record numbers of visitors in 2023.

With no opening date as yet confirmed, the brand website is still currently the only place you can buy Maniere de Voir clothing and accessories.

Who are Maniere de Voir?

MDV is a UK streetwear clothing brand started by Reece Wabara, a former England U20 and Manchester City Footballer. In 2014 he got together with Benjamin Francis and Lewis Morgan of Gymshark who grew up together in Bromsgrove, Worcestershire.

The clothing line aims for innovative design, with affordable prices, which is capturing attention in the retail market well. Reece wants to be the market leader for multi-gender fashion, and they are on their way to succeeding in that goal. There are not many brands like Maniere de Voir, who effortlessly combine sports luxe with style.

MDV is known for its minimalistic and bold designs, which are a huge hit with their customer base. Their collections are designed to last, with items such as joggers, hoodies and jackets that can be worn in any season. The brand also offers a wide range of accessories such as caps, belts and bags, which are a great way to add a bit of individuality to any outfit.

MDV has also gained attention for its philanthropic efforts, such as donating to charities, creating jobs and using sustainable materials. MDV is leading the way in the streetwear market, and it is clear that Reece Wabara and his team are passionate about the clothing they are producing.
